Output c26d56ad063d38c08a7620ad79d318b95ce099b3871854849dcf3a81af85b037:0

value
2051894
script pubkey
OP_0 OP_PUSHBYTES_20 1f31a295531e8e3508e757a4cb5899345360a043
address
bc1qruc6992nr68r2z8827jvkkyex3fkpgzrwvjfch
transaction
c26d56ad063d38c08a7620ad79d318b95ce099b3871854849dcf3a81af85b037
confirmations
144153
spent
true